Understanding Spinal Arthritis
Spinal arthritis occurs when the cartilage between the joints in your spine breaks down, leading to inflammation, stiffness, and pain. Over time, this wear-and-tear can cause the bones to rub together, creating that constant ache or sharp discomfort you feel. This condition can be caused by aging, repetitive stress on the spine, past injuries, or even genetic factors. The good news? There are ways to manage and even reduce the pain, so you can get back to doing what you love.

Top 5 Treatments for Spinal Arthritis
- Chiropractic Adjustments
Gentle spinal manipulations align your joints and reduce pressure on affected areas, helping alleviate pain and improve motion. - Physical Therapy
Customized exercises strengthen muscles around your spine, improving support and reducing strain on arthritic joints. - Massage Therapy
Therapeutic massage eases tension in surrounding muscles, improving blood flow and reducing pain caused by stiffness and inflammation. - Lifestyle Modifications
Weight management, posture corrections, and ergonomic changes can significantly lower stress on your spine and reduce symptoms. - Anti-Inflammatory Treatments
Supplements, medications, or dietary changes can target inflammation directly, offering faster relief from pain.
FAQ
What are the early signs of spinal arthritis?
Stiffness in the morning, persistent back pain, and difficulty bending or twisting are common signs.
Is spinal arthritis curable?
While there’s no cure, treatments can effectively manage symptoms and slow progression.
How long does it take to see improvement with treatment?
Many patients notice relief within a few weeks, but consistent care is key to lasting results.
Can spinal arthritis cause nerve problems?
Yes, untreated arthritis may lead to nerve compression, causing numbness or tingling.

What can I do at home to help manage the condition?
Staying active, maintaining a healthy weight, and practicing good posture can reduce symptoms.
Does diet play a role in spinal arthritis?
Yes, anti-inflammatory foods like fish, nuts, and leafy greens can help reduce symptoms.
